The key to the 3 tank aerobic septic system’s functionality lies in the aerobic bacterial processes. In an aeration system, the bacteria live either in sludge or in basins. How does a 3 tank aerobic septic system work? An aerobic treatment system (ats), often called an aerobic septic system, is a small scale sewage treatment system similar to a septic tank. An aerobic septic system utilizes oxygen to break down organic matter more efficiently than traditional anaerobic systems. Then a surface aerator or diffusion aerator sends extra oxygen.
